Transaction 70029127876656fb33e3eae11be39fc3d200e4b4b63c17f0e9f5e9cbff25dee8

1 Input
2 Outputs
  • 70029127876656fb33e3eae11be39fc3d200e4b4b63c17f0e9f5e9cbff25dee8:0
  • value  311964883
    address  3CiDB4AQwZxrwnH8bEu2aD1yDYAkRL34gG
  • 70029127876656fb33e3eae11be39fc3d200e4b4b63c17f0e9f5e9cbff25dee8:1
  • value  101000
    address  39PQftwsaawdAJeezD1KFUxR4z4SDAGkFV